Subject: Marketing budget — Q3 reduction

Team,

Effective next month, marketing spend drops 22%. Campaigns for Lumivane and the Drexhall rollout are paused. Sales leads should expect fewer inbound leads through Q3 and plan outbound accordingly. Event sponsorships in Castermouth are cancelled; the Verlow trade show stays. Do not communicate externally until Priya circulates talking points Friday. Questions go to your regional head. The rationale is summarized in the confidential note below.

board note of kageg-bahof: The renewal with Holwynax Holdings closes at $2 million a year, 5 percent below the last contract. Project Ulaath slips by two quarters because of the supplier delay.

## Runbook: Wavepeek preview generation

Wavepeek renders the little waveform thumbnails you see on every clip in Chordbin. Uploads land in the intake bucket, a worker decodes the audio, downsamples to peak pairs, and writes a PNG plus a JSON envelope. If previews go stale or blank, it's almost always the worker pool choking on oversized lossless files — check the dead-letter queue first. Reviewers: the resolution and peak-window logic below is load-bearing, so flag any change. Current rendering config follows.

config for tagep-yajef:
ulawyn:
  log_level: error
  metrics_host: metrics.ulawyn.lumiclabs.internal
  pin: 0564
  pool_size: 32

Management Meeting Minutes — Second-Source Supplier Search

Quick recap for the board: we've kicked off the search for a backup supplier for the Qorin valve assemblies. Sole reliance on Madsen Fabrication is getting risky — two late shipments this quarter. Tomas Reyhall has shortlisted three candidates; site visits start next month. Targeting a signed agreement by spring. The confidential direction note sits just below.

confidential, tagag-kahof: Rusathox Partners plans to lower the Gorox list price by 63 percent in December.